Abstract
A sorting apparatus is composed of sort processors connected in a pipeline fashion. Each sort processor 106 merge sorts data from the preceding sort processor and then outputs the merge sort result to the succeeding sort processor. The sort processor includes sort core portions and a front end internal storage and a back end internal storage for the respective sort core portions. Outside the sort processors, there are added external memories for the respective sort core portions. The front and back end internal storages and the external memories constitute a local memory. The sort core portions use, when a faulty area is found in the local memory, part of the front end and back end internal storages as an alternative memory.
